Sonny Letner, age 81 of Oneida, TN passed away on Saturday, September 10, 2022, at the University of Tennessee Medical Center in Knoxville, TN. Born in Meigs County, TN on January 8, 1941, he was the son of the late Ralph and Natia Letner. He was a member of Salem Baptist Church.
In addition to his parents, he was preceded in death by his children, Danny, Kevin, and Trina Letner; brothers, Gerald, Don, Tommy, and Dean; sister, Angie; mother and father-in-law, Arthur and Pearl Duncan; granddaughter, Cierra Letner; brothers and sisters-in-law, Pete and Bonnie Walters, Sheila Radford, Bill and Barbara Duncan.
He is survived by his wife, Betty Letner; daughter, Bridget and Steve Jeffers; brothers, Bobby, Steve and wife Melinda; sisters, Janet and Wayne Jones, Evelyn, Sally, Carol, Eva May, Sheila and Linda; grandchildren, Daniel and Amy Prewitt, Adam and Brooklyne Jeffers, Sonni and Ryan Strunk, Stevi and Tanner Boshears, William Young, Hunter Letner; great grandchildren; Dalton, Caleb, Devin and Carlie Prewitt, Karlie Branscum, Aleeyah, Pazelynn, Brinleigh, Avery, Addison Jeffers, Serayah and Josie Strunk, Harper and Titan Boshears; brother and sister-in-law, Wayne and Teresa Duncan; many other special relatives and friends.
Friends may visit with the Letner family on Wednesday, September 14, 2022 from 4 p.m. until time of the funeral service at 5 p.m. in the chapel of West-Murley Funeral Home with Bro. Josh Lay and Adam Jeffers officiating. Music will be provided by Salem’s Little Angels.
Committal service will follow in the Wilhite Cemetery in the Buffalo community. Pallbearers will be: Daniel Prewitt, Dalton Prewitt, William Young, Greg Letner, Adam Jeffers, Caleb Prewitt, Devin Prewitt, and Ryan Strunk.
